Transaction 317a0b170849d2218a1640bee211023427f64a04874226113cf3b7c382e489ee
1 Input
1 Output
-
317a0b170849d2218a1640bee211023427f64a04874226113cf3b7c382e489ee:0
- value
- 25193759
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ab7329d4fe8a713c62eb7f4498e5d31d351b3855
- address
- bc1q4dejn4873fcnccht0azf3ewnr563kwz4wawspf